SRB on "Setting up IDRIVE One as a wireless base"
I'm trying to set up using a Wi-Fi connection, but I have my SSID name broadcast turned off. I contacted tech support and was told that there was no way to enter the name and password manually, and not only would I have to turn name broadcast on, but that I would have to leave it on. Is there a way around this or will I have to use a patch cable and a port on my router?

IDrive on "After backup failure, backup taking 12 hours"
Data will be considered for full backup only if there are any new files to backup or if there are any changes in the file path or file name. Change in account password should not affect the backup performance. Please verify if you are using the latest version of the IDrive application. We recommend you to verify logs and check if the data is is considered for full backup or incremental backup. Please forward your observations and logs using "send error report" option.
